Configuring the build (-*- outline -*-) Peter Williams ** Configuring the build It's pretty easy. You can create two files in this directory to tweak settings: pre-config.make and config.make. pre-config.make is included before $(BUILD_PLATFORM).make and $(PROFILE).make, so you can set either of these variables if you want to change the default. Just about any other change should go in config.make, which is included after $(BUILD_PLATFORM).make and $(PROFILE).make, so you can use the values defined in those files if you wish. For example, MCS_FLAGS = $(DEFAULT_MCS_FLAGS) /my-experimental-optimizer-flag or something. (You shouldn't need to edit any of the existing Makefiles for site-specific hacks. CVS would complain at you and `make dist' wouldn't be happy.)
